Gifts must be evidenced by a letter signed by the donor, called a gift letter. The gift letter must: specify the actual or the maximum dollar amount of the gift; include the donor’s statement that no repayment is expected; and. indicate the donor’s name, address, telephone number, and relationship to the borrower. jim\u0027s small engine repair paw paw miWebApr 5, 2024 · payment of delinquent taxes or delinquent HOA assessments.
